你查询的IP:[122.51.239.75]  地理位置:中国–上海–上海

最新查询60.63.107.238 210.26.15.230 122.157.64.76 123.52.222.68 119.162.141.5 211.160.6.182 119.144.12.47 222.125.50.93 125.32.106.17 122.51.239.75 202.120.34.52 202.131.208.210 203.80.144.252 202.90.148.36 221.12.128.31 202.41.240.185 202.122.32.29 203.166.160.197 203.174.7.80 119.78.148.86 123.144.191.217 122.119.239.247 61.240.11.158 116.4.15.249 202.90.252.97 203.174.7.203 121.52.208.254 202.38.128.86 117.121.242.154 211.80.106.73 124.72.74.98